The below stocks have been identified as having potential to register bigger than normal share price moves (up or down) today based on the news cited
BHP Billiton (BHP.L) - Said it will take a $2 billion impairment on its U.S. shale operations, the third write-down in as many years. Closing price 1236.00p (Reuters)
IAG, Aer Lingus - (IAG.l) (AERL.L) - IAG has gained European Union antitrust approval for its €1.3bn bid for Irish carrier Aer Lingus after agreeing to make concessions to ease competition worries. Closing prices 552.00p, 2.4700c (Reuters)
Vodafone (VOD.L) Goldman Sachs cuts to "neutral" from "buy" and removes stock from its pan-European Buy list. Closing price 237.90p (Reuters)
Burberry (BRBY.L) - 8% underlying growth in Q1 retail revenue, a slowdown from the previous period. It made £407m of retail revenue in the three months to June 30 compared to analysts' average forecast of £414m. Closing price 1620.00p (Reuters)
Rio Tinto (RIO.L), BHP Billiton (BLT.L), Glencore (GLEN.L) and Anglo American (AAL.L) - GDP growth up 7% in Q2, steady with the previous quarter and slightly better than analysts' forecasts. Further stimulus still expected after the quarter ended with a stock market crash. Closing Prices 2580.00p, 1236.80p, 248.55p and 869.50p (Reuters)
Meggitt (MGGT.L) - The Daily Mail newspaper's stock market report cited revived gossip that United Technologies or Honeywell could be eyeing a bid for the aircrafts parts manufacturer. Closing Price 488.30p (Reuters)
Halfords (HFD.L) - On track after Q1 underlying sales rose. Q1 Retail +4.2%; Cycling growth against strong comparative period; Car maintenance good performance driven by parts (+7%) and workshop (+10%). Closing Prices 550p (Reuters)
